Q: Is 103,004,206 a Prime Number?
A: No, 103,004,206 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 103004206 can be evenly divided by 1 2 19 38 59 118 1,121 2,242 45,943 91,886 872,917 1,745,834 2,710,637 5,421,274 51,502,103 and 103,004,206, with no remainder.
Since 103,004,206 cannot be divided by just 1 and 103,004,206, it is not a prime number.
